A couple of the rides:

Na’vi River Journey.

Guests travel down a sacred river deep into a bioluminescent rainforest. Aboard reed boats, they float past exotic glowing plants and Pandora creatures into the midst of a musical Na’vi ceremony. The mystical journey culminates in an encounter with the breathtaking Na’vi Shaman of songs whom is deeply connected with Pandora’s life force and sends positive energy into the forest through her music.

Flight of Passage.

For me, this is the best ride I have ever encountered at Disney. Avatar Flight of Passage puts you on a winged mountain banshee that launches each guest on an exhilarating experience over the awe-inspiring world of Pandora. Guest will actually feel the Banshee breathe beneath them as they soar through the forest and pass floating mountains. They will also feel the wind on their face as they fly, will get sprayed with mist as they near waterfalls and oceans, smell the forest, the flowers and the ocean. What was a rite of passage for Na’vi in Cameron’s film becomes a multisensory experience for guests seeking the ultimate adventure – an encounter with the most feared predator of Pandora, the Great Leonopteryx.
